
/*#contenu .couleur_0,#contenu .style_couleur0,.coin_fond_0{
}*/

#contenu .paragraphe p.premier
{
}
#contenu .paragraphe a
{	color:#6a4d4c;	}
#contenu .paragraphe a:hover
{	color:#c40009;	}
/* ------------------------------------- LIENS DOCS ET LIENS */
#contenu div.titre_liens_docs {
	margin-left:50px;
	font-weight:bold;
}
ul.document, ul.lien {	
	margin:5px 0 10px 0;
	padding:0;
	line-height:1.4em;
}
ul.document {	
	margin-left:80px;
}
ul.document li {list-style:none;}
ul.lien { margin-left:90px;}
ul.lien li {margin:0;padding:0;}

ul.document li a, ul.lien li a{
	font-weight:bold;
	text-decoration:none;
}

/* ------------------------------------- COULEUR DEFAUT 0 */
#contenu .couleur_0 div.titre_liens_docs
{	border-bottom:1px solid #6a4d4c;	}
#contenu .couleur_0 p a,
#contenu .couleur_0 ul.document li a,
#contenu .couleur_0 ul.lien li a
{	color:#6a4d4c;
line-height:1.4em;	}
#contenu .couleur_0 p a:hover,
#contenu .couleur_0 ul.document li a:hover,
#contenu .couleur_0 ul.lien li a:hover
{	color:#c40009;	}
/*#contenu .couleur_0 */ul.document li a
{	background:url(../images/contenu_bg_document.png) no-repeat 0 1px;
	padding-left:18px;
	list-style: none;
	}
/*#contenu .couleur_0 */ul.lien li a
{	list-style:circle;
	list-style-type:circle;
		}
/* ------------------------------------- COULEUR FOND RUBRIQUE 1 */
#contenu .couleur_1
{
	background-color:#c40009;
	color:white;
}
#contenu .couleur_1 a,
#contenu .couleur_1 p a,
#contenu .couleur_1 ul.document li a,
#contenu .couleur_1 ul.lien li a
{	color:#fff;
line-height:1.4em;
	}
#contenu .couleur_1 p a:hover,
#contenu .couleur_1 ul.document li a:hover,
#contenu .couleur_1 ul.lien li a:hover
{	color:#fff;
	text-decoration:underline;
	}
#contenu .couleur_1 div.titre_liens_docs
{
	color:#fff;
	border-bottom:1px solid white;
}
/* ------------------------------------- REMONTER HOME */
a.remonter_haut_page
{
	position:absolute;
	right:0;
	bottom:0;
	margin:0;padding:0;
	padding-left:10px;
	padding-right:20px;
	padding-bottom:5px;
	color:#6a4d4c;
	background:url(../images/contenu_bg_remonter_haut_page.png) no-repeat 0 4px;
}

#contenu .couleur_1 a.remonter_haut_page
{
	color:white;
	background:url(../images/contenu_bg_remonter_haut_page_blanc.png) no-repeat 0 4px;
}

/* ------------------------------------- TABLEAUX */
div.tableau
{
	margin-left:50px;
	padding-top:42px;
	padding-bottom:20px;
}

div.tableau h2.h2_tableau
{
	color:#c40009;
	font-size:1.5em;
	background:none;
	padding:0;
}

div.tableau p.tableau
{
	color:#6a4d4c;
	margin:0;padding:0;
}

div.tableau table.tableau
{
	border-collapse:collapse;
	text-align:center;
	width:97%;
}
div.tableau table.tableau tr.tfoot
{	background:#e2711f;border:none;	}
div.tableau table.tableau tr.tfoot td
{	height:5px;line-height:5px;border:none;	}

div.tableau table.tableau thead
{
	background:#c40009 url(../images/contenu_bg_tableau_haut_droite.png) no-repeat right 0;
	border-bottom:1px solid #dbd3d0;
}
div.tableau table.tableau thead th.premier
{
	background:#c40009 url(../images/contenu_bg_tableau_haut_gauche.png) no-repeat 0 0;
	border-left:none;
}

div.tableau table.tableau tbody td,
div.tableau table.tableau thead th
{
	height:26px;
	line-height:26px;
	padding-left:15px;
	padding-right:20px;
}

div.tableau table.tableau thead th
{
	border-left:1px solid #e2d4cf;
	color:white;
}

div.tableau table.tableau tbody td
{
	border-left:1px solid #e2d4cf;
	color:#6a4d4c;
}

div.tableau table.tableau tbody td.premier_td
{
	border-left:none;
}

div.tableau table.tableau tr.pair td
{	background:#e2d4cf;	}
div.tableau table.tableau tr.impair td
{	background:#ece3e0;	}



#contenu ul.images,#contenu ul.images_gauche,#contenu ul.images_droite,#contenu ul.galerie_photo{
	margin:0;
	padding:0;
	border:0;
	list-style-type:none;
}
#contenu ul.images_gauche,.float_left{
	float:left;
}
#contenu ul.images_droite,.float_right{
	float:right;
	padding-left:20px;
}
#contenu ul.images_gauche img{
	margin-right:10px;
	float:none;
}
#contenu ul.images_droite img{
	margin-left:10px;
	float:none;
}
#contenu ul.galerie_photo li{
	float:left;
	text-align:center;
	background-color:#eee;
	border:1px solid #000;
	margin-left:5px;
	margin-bottom:10px;
	padding-top:5px;
}

#contenu img.img_principale_galerie{
	margin:10px;
}

#contenu div.paragraphe{
	position:relative;
	overflow:visible;
	zoom:1;
	margin:0;
	padding:0;
	padding-bottom:10px;
}
.div_paragraphe
{	padding: 0 25px 5px 50px;	}

